		<title>PrivateJet.com sells for $30 million in cash and stock</title>
		<description><![CDATA[In an official statement, Nations Luxury Transportation purchased PrivateJet.com for $30.18 million dollars in cash and stock, marking what many believe to be the largest standing domain name purchase in history.  <a href="http://www.domainholdings.com/blog/domain-brokerage/privatejet-com-sells-for-30-million/">Continue reading <span class="meta-nav">&#8594;</span></a>]]></description>
